Why is Emma such a popular name?
For five consecutive years, Emma has been the most popular name for girls in the United States, beating out number-two name Olivia in each of those years. Last year was also the 15th in a row that Emma has been in the top 3.

Is Emma a Norwegian name?
Emma is a popular name in Norway, with Ancient Germanic and Old Norse origins. It comes from the Germanic word ermen, meaning “whole” or “universal”, so is a good name for a well-rounded girl.
